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
367249082 4652251743 3591101 15278577361 92569078
10 309 2037827
10 309 2037827
086 53557976 5868645 393529 974
All about undefined
Interested in learning more?
10 309 2037827
086 53557976 5868645 393529 974
See more
82785474 56 3977
38953852 66 82406967441
See more
08 191926498 9574
33160606 69000607 4926930051
See more